Guangzhou Issues Plan for Low-altitude Economy Development, Aiming for 150 Billion Yuan by 2027

TapTechNews May 31st news, TapTechNews learned from the official website of the Guangzhou Municipal People's Government that Guangzhou has today issued the 'Guangzhou Low-altitude Economy Development Implementation Plan' and proposed a series of development goals: By 2027, the overall scale of Guangzhou's low-altitude economy will reach about 150 billion yuan. General aviation infrastructure and flight environment have been significantly improved, an industrial system dominated by high-end smart manufacturing has initially formed, the reform of low-altitude airspace management has achieved results, the low-altitude flight service support capacity has been significantly enhanced, and the technological innovation level in the low-altitude field leads the country.

In terms of intelligent aircraft sales, the first flying car 'ade in Guangzhou' will be sold globally, promoting the related manufacturing industries of manned aircraft, flying cars, cargo drones, consumer drones, traditional helicopters, etc. to achieve an industrial output value of more than 110 billion yuan.

In the aspect of urban advanced air traffic commercial operation, promote Guangzhou to become the first city in China to carry out commercial manned flight operations, and the market scale of key operation service fields such as low-altitude economy cross-border flights, business customization, short-haul passenger transport, cultural tourism consumption, logistics and transportation, emergency medical treatment, and exhibition services reaches 300 billion yuan.

The 'Plan' proposes to strengthen the construction of low-altitude infrastructure, including the following measures:

Build a low-altitude flight service station. Build a Guangzhou Class A low-altitude flight service station, study and determine the functional positioning, personnel composition, and operation mode of the service station, and establish a regular and institutionalized coordinated relationship and work process between the service station and the military and civil aviation air traffic control operation agencies. Build a low-altitude flight service and supervision system to provide control services such as flight plans, aviation intelligence, aviation meteorology, emergency rescue, and dynamic monitoring for general aviation flight activities, and provide low-altitude flight-related services for flight users and the general public.

Build a low-altitude intelligent Internet of Things infrastructure. According to the requirements of low-altitude flight activities and the division of low-altitude airspace and routes in the Guangzhou area, promote the construction of low-altitude intelligent networked information infrastructure such as Beidou ground augmentation stations, dedicated 4G/5G communication base stations, ADS-B base stations, and small meteorological observation stations in stages in the whole city, develop a digital twin model of low-altitude airspace, and research and develop supporting software facilities to build a digital base for low-altitude flight monitoring. Break through key core technologies such as refined allocation of low-altitude airspace resources, operation interval control, autonomous obstacle avoidance of flight conflicts, and noise control to achieve full coverage of communication, navigation, and monitoring capabilities for low-altitude flights in the city.

Build a ground supporting infrastructure system. Overall plan the existing and newly built low-altitude ground supporting infrastructure in urban areas, build a takeoff and landing network that has functions such as storing, taking off and landing, charging, and maintenance for various low-altitude aircraft, covering multiple models and multiple scenarios. Build the first runway-type general airport in Guangzhou, build more than 5 new hub-type vertical takeoff and landing fields and more than 100 regular-use takeoff and landing points, and hundreds of community grid takeoff and landing points to meet the needs of low-altitude application scenarios in Guangzhou.

Classify and demarcate low-altitude airspace and low-altitude routes. Fully draw on the successful experience of the national low-altitude airspace management reform pilot project, promote the introduction of the 'Guangzhou Low-altitude Airspace Classification Demarcation Plan' and the 'Guangzhou Low-altitude Route Demarcation Plan' according to the national airspace classification method, announce them to the public in due course, and sign a 'Guangzhou Low-altitude Airspace Management Coordination Operation Guarantee Agreement' with the military and civil aviation air traffic control departments. Take advantage of the advantage of Guangzhou's river network to accelerate the planning of routes and the opening up of demonstration areas.
